NAME

       hesv_comp_grp - LDL: computational routines (factor, cond, etc.)

SYNOPSIS

   Modules
       — full, rook v1 —
       {he,sy}con:     condition number estimate
       {he,sy}trf:     triangular factor
       la{he,sy}f:     step in hetrf
       {he,sy}tf2:     triangular factor, level 2
       {he,sy}trs:     triangular solve using factor
       {he,sy}tri:     triangular inverse
       {he,sy}rfs:     iterative refinement
       {he,sy}rfsx:    iterative refinement, expert
       {he,sy}equb:    equilibration, power of 2
       syconv:         convert to/from L and D from hetrf
       {he,sy}con_3:   condition number estimate
       {he,sy}tri2:    inverse
       {he,sy}tri2x:   inverse
       {he,sy}tri_3:   inverse
       {he,sy}tri_3x:  inverse
       {he,sy}trs2:    solve using factor
       {he,sy}trs_3:   solve using factor
       {he,sy}swapr:         apply 2-sided permutation
       la_hercond:           Skeel condition number estimate
       la_herfsx_extended:   step in herfsx
       la_herpvgrw:          reciprocal pivot growth
       — packed, rook v1 —
       {hp,sp}con:     condition number estimate
       {hp,sp}trf:     triangular factor
       {hp,sp}trs:     triangular solve using factor
       {hp,sp}tri:     triangular inverse
       {hp,sp}rfs:     iterative refinement
       — full, rook v2 —
       {he,sy}con_rook:  condition number estimate
       {he,sy}trf_rook:  triangular factor
       la{he,sy}f_rook:  triangular factor step
       {he,sy}tf2_rook:  triangular factor, level 2
       {he,sy}trs_rook:  triangular solve using factor
       {he,sy}tri_rook:  triangular inverse
       — full, rook v3 —
       {he,sy}trf_rk:  triangular factor
       la{he,sy}f_rk:  triangular factor step
       {he,sy}tf2_rk:  triangular factor, level 2
       syconvf:        convert to/from hetrf      to hetrf_rk format
       syconvf_rook:   convert to/from hetrf_rook to hetrf_rk format
       — full, Aasen —
       {he,sy}trf_aa:  triangular factor
       la{he,sy}f_aa:  triangular factor partial factor
       {he,sy}trs_aa:  triangular solve using factor
       — full, Aasen, blocked 2-stage —
       {he,sy}trf_aa_2stage:  triangular factor
       {he,sy}trs_aa_2stage:  triangular solve using factor
